Comprehensive Guide to Leasehold Alteration Application

What is the Application for Landlord's Permission to Carry Out an Alteration to a Leasehold Dwelling?

The application for landlord's permission is a formal document that leaseholders use to request approval for making alterations to their leasehold dwelling. This application is crucial as it ensures leaseholders comply with their lease agreements, thereby protecting their interests. Failing to obtain the landlord's permission may lead to disputes or penalties.
Common types of alterations that may require this form include structural changes, renovations, or the addition of fixtures. Understanding these requirements helps leaseholders navigate their rights and obligations effectively.

Key Features of the Leasehold Alteration Application

This application includes several key components that leaseholders must fill out accurately. Some notable features include specific fillable fields for the alteration address, contractor details, and a description of the proposed changes. Additionally, the form requires leaseholders to indicate whether they have received the necessary planning or building regulation approvals.
Providing a diagram or plan of the intended alterations is also a crucial part of the application, ensuring that landlords have a clear understanding of the changes being proposed.

What Happens After You Submit the Application?

Once the application is submitted, the landlord will review it within a specified timeframe. There are several potential outcomes: the application may be approved, denied, or returned for additional information. If approved, leaseholders can proceed with their planned alterations in adherence with any conditions set forth by the landlord.
If the application is denied, leaseholders may have the opportunity to address the concerns raised and resubmit their request, ensuring they remain in compliance with their lease terms.
